Special Meeting Summary (May 28, 2025)

A special meeting of the Eastridge Hills HOA Board was convened to elect officers, establish committee structure, address ongoing contracts, and set policy direction following a successful recall election.

Board Officer Elections

  • President: Carolyn Goodall
  • Treasurer: Eddie Williams
  • Secretary: William Wesley (absent but nominated and approved)

Carolyn was first appointed Chair Pro Tem to facilitate the meeting. A quorum of two board members (Carolyn and Eddie) was present, allowing the meeting to proceed in accordance with governing procedures.


🔐 Banking and Financial Authority

  • The Board voted to remove previous signers from the association’s bank accounts and authorize Carolyn and Eddie as new signers.
  • Priscilla Marin (management company) will handle bank coordination and signature cards. New authority expected within 10 business days.
  • The Board reaffirmed control of tax and investment authority is now with the newly elected officers.

🐐 Contract Review: Grazing Services

  • A $4,500 contract was signed by the prior board for seasonal goat grazing of 8.5 acres of HOA open space.
  • Due to prior fence damage, the Board expressed intent to review fencing issues and will schedule an executive meeting on June 4th to evaluate liability and leadership concerns.
  • Homeowners are encouraged to inspect and secure their fences in anticipation of the grazing event.

🚫 Gate Signage and Safety

  • Board unanimously approved additional signage at the back gate to deter drivers from entering through the exit lane.
  • Signage will include Spanish language and universal symbols (“Do Not Enter”, “Stop”).
  • Priscilla will coordinate with the sign vendor to avoid duplicating or replacing recently updated signs.

🔥 Unfinished Business Resolutions

  • Red Curbs & No Parking Signs: The Board voted to cancel plans to paint curbs and remove “No Parking” signs in cul-de-sacs.
  • Recall Election Special Assessment: Homeowners who paid the $123.00 recall election fee will receive a full credit on their July statement. The Board recognized prior lack of transparency and affirmed the refund as a goodwill measure.

🧾 Reserve Study

  • No changes were made to the approved Reserve Study contract for FY2026.
  • The Board aims to ensure clear, community-friendly summaries of financial and reserve documents moving forward, citing frequent member feedback for more understandable reporting.
